KP Labour Minister Faisal Khan Tarakai pledged timely action on public grievances during his visit to Nowshera, reaffirming the provincial government’s commitment to public service.
Nowshera: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Labour Minister Faisal Khan Tarakai received a warm welcome during his visit to Barah Banda in Nowshera, where he was greeted by Member of the Provincial Assembly Zar Alam Khan, local party leaders and workers.
During the visit, party workers welcomed the minister and briefed him on a range of public issues affecting the area. Residents highlighted local concerns and urged the provincial government to ensure timely solutions to their longstanding problems.
Faisal Khan Tarakai listened in detail to the complaints and suggestions presented by citizens and party workers. He assured them that the relevant authorities would be directed to take prompt and effective measures to address the issues raised.
The minister said serving the public, resolving citizens’ problems without unnecessary delay and maintaining regular contact with party workers remain among the top priorities of the Khyber Pakhtunkhwa government. He added that the provincial administration is committed to improving public services and responding effectively to the needs of local communities.
